Can from Gulating. Slightly unclear golden body under a big, foamy white head. Aroma has malt with distinct caramel and toffee. Taste is sweet malt with roasted, slightly bitter caramel. Not as sweet as expected at all. In the world of extreme sweet pastry beers with artificial flavours this is quite different. More towards a kind of old-fashioned approach, if you put it that way. It does not taste like these typical kind of classic Christmas beer with caramel malt either, this is more like a golden ale or something added with Werther's Original caramel candies. Unusually but quite nice actually. Medium body and a rather dry, caramel finish.
